Suspects set free

26th June 2009

Share:
Tweet this story Send to facebook Add to Stumbleupon Add to Delicious Digg this story Sent to Reddit
Over 20 men suspected of terrorist activities have been freed by Afghan authorities after being seized by Poland’s military unit, GROM.


Three of the suspects, whose clothes were found to have traces of explosives on them, are believed to have orchestrated an attack last month which left a Polish soldier with serious injuries.  

The situation may send out signals to the Taliban that they are able to attack Polish troops and go unpunished. Some fear it might also give Polish soldiers reason to believe they are risking their lives in vain. ...
